C. L. Tien is a scholar working on Computational Mechanics, Civil and Structural Engineering and Atmospheric Science. According to data from OpenAlex, C. L. Tien has authored 38 papers receiving a total of 507 indexed citations (citations by other indexed papers that have themselves been cited), including 18 papers in Computational Mechanics, 6 papers in Civil and Structural Engineering and 6 papers in Atmospheric Science. Recurrent topics in C. L. Tien's work include Radiative Heat Transfer Studies (10 papers), Thermal Radiation and Cooling Technologies (4 papers) and Combustion and flame dynamics (4 papers). C. L. Tien is often cited by papers focused on Radiative Heat Transfer Studies (10 papers), Thermal Radiation and Cooling Technologies (4 papers) and Combustion and flame dynamics (4 papers). C. L. Tien collaborates with scholars based in United States, Taiwan and South Korea. C. L. Tien's co-authors include Sunil Kumar, Bruce L. Drolen, Kambiz Vafai, Seung Ho Park, L.C. Chow, A. Dayan, K. H. Sun, G. R. Cunnington, Kwang Hwa Chung and Taiqing Qiu and has published in prestigious journals such as International Journal of Heat and Mass Transfer, AIAA Journal and Review of Scientific Instruments.
